Chronic Bad Breath or Undesirable Taste
To resolve persistent foul-smelling breath or an unpleasant taste, seek advice from a dental specialist promptly. While foul-smelling breath can be triggered by numerous factors such as bad oral hygiene or particular foods, chronic foul breath that lingers regardless of regular cleaning and flossing might suggest an underlying oral health problem.
A dental doctor can aid determine the source of your halitosis and offer proper treatment. They'll conduct a comprehensive assessment of your mouth, teeth, and gums to analyze any type of possible problems such as periodontal condition, dental caries, or oral infections.
In addition, an unpleasant preference in your mouth could be a sign of a dental health issue that needs immediate attention. Don't disregard these signs; look for the proficiency of an oral surgeon to resolve the concern and restore fresh breath and a pleasurable taste in your mouth.

Loose or Shifting Teeth
If you see your teeth becoming loosened or moving, it's vital to speak with a dental doctor immediately. This could be an indication of a major oral concern that needs prompt attention. Below are some reasons why loose or moving teeth shouldn't be overlooked:
- Injury or injury: Teeth can become loosened as a result of an impact to the mouth or face. An oral cosmetic surgeon can assess the damages and give appropriate therapy.
- Periodontal disease: Advanced gum disease can cause the supporting frameworks of the teeth to weaken, leading to tooth flexibility. An oral cosmetic surgeon can evaluate the degree of the condition and recommend therapy options.
- Tooth decay: Extreme decay can threaten the integrity of the tooth, creating it to come to be loosened. A dental specialist can identify the very best course of action.
- Bite problems: Misaligned teeth or an improper bite can trigger teeth to change or become loosened. A dental cosmetic surgeon can deal with these concerns and stop more damage.
- Bone loss: In some cases, bone loss in the jaw can cause teeth to become loosened. An oral surgeon can analyze the situation and provide proper therapy to bring back stability.
